Some programs are very structured and firmly insist onadherence to a details prepare for consuming with clear policies relating tothe amounts and kinds of food to be eaten. Others are extra flexibleand motivate patients to eat what fits with gradualprogression towards improved eating patterns. Sometimes there is a mix of preparing dishes in advancealongside approaches that urge versatility or spontaneity in eatingwith little attention to the potential impact of variances andcontradictions in methods. As an example, Brunzell and Hendrickson-Nelson [13] suggest intending consuming beforehand however likewise advocateeating in response to hunger and satiation signs without clearing up whento use these various techniques. Reliable psychological assistance services can minimize a patient's resistance to diet plan adjustments and weight gain goals. These solutions can likewise identify and attend to signs and symptoms of stress and anxiety and similar worries prior to they become extreme sufficient to trigger the client to decline additional treatment. For lots of people in recuperation from an eating condition, the thought of weight adjustments (particularly weight gain) might create a great deal of anxiety, worry and bewilder.

Accumulating information on clinical features relating to diet regimen and ICP is vital, to collect evidence concerning the efficiency of dietetic and interprofessional treatment in eating disorders. Data will certainly be obtained from individuals at baseline, mid-treatment, at the end of therapy and post-treatment, and leave surveys acquired from any kind of participants that do not complete the treatment. Future research study will certainly likewise take into consideration the role of general practitioners and psychiatrists alongside CBT-IE, along with the impact of CBT-IE in various other eating disorder presentations where poor nutrition might take place such as Bulimia Nervosa. With the Exchange System, eating disorder clients intentionallyor often inadvertently have a tendency to "cut" Calories by pickinga smaller sized quantity of food or lower Calorie food items (e.g. slim, diet plan foods) having the very same exchange value.
